EU society must give up a number of freedoms and mobilize to wage all-out war, former Commander-in-Chief of the Ukrainian Armed Forces and Ukraine’s new ambassador to the UK Valery Zaluzhny said on July 22 at a conference of the British Royal United Defence Studies Institute (RUSI).
“Society must agree to temporarily give up a number of freedoms for the sake of survival.”RIA Novosti quotes Zaluzhny as saying.
He explained that this measure is necessary in the conditions of modern warfare, which is “total character”.
According to the former commander-in-chief of the Armed Forces of Ukraine, such wars require the efforts of the entire society, not just the army. At the same time, politicians are obliged to “mobilize society”.
Zaluzhny pointed out “perhaps the most complex and important component” in the whole matter – “community preparedness”.
He stressed that under these conditions it is necessary to comply with “honest and transparent communication between government and people”.
